WebMelozone cabanisi ( Sclater, PL; Salvin, O 1868) Cabanis's ground sparrow or Costa Rican ground sparrow (Melozone cabanisi), is an American sparrow. It previously was … WebMay 28, 2024 · The Cabanis’s Ground-Sparrow is a bird in trouble. Listed as Near Threatened, this charismatic species has a tiny distribution restricted to central Costa Rica, especially in the Central Valley. It doesn’t require forest but the coffee farms and scrubby green space it does need are under constant pressure of being destroyed and replaced ... cheshire brewhouse brewery

Date taken. 7th … cheshire brewhouse elephants breathWebThe Cabanis's ground sparrow was previously considered a subspecies. It is found typically at altitudes between 600 and 1600 m in the undergrowth and thickets of semi-open woodland, coffee plantations, hedgerows and large gardens. Biome Anthropogenic biome. Forest.
